Assalamualaikum sobat. Semoga tetap sehat dan selalu dalam lindunganNya. Amin. Bertemu lagi nih. Langsung saja, kali ini saya akan sharing mengenai Koneksi pada OOP .
Langsung saja ya...
A. Pendahuluan
1. Pengertian
koneksi/ko·nek·si/ /konéksi/ n 1 hubungan yang dapat memudahkan (melancarkan) segala urusan (kegiatan); 2 cak kenalan.
koneksi/ko·nek·si/ /konéksi/ n 1 hubungan yang dapat memudahkan (melancarkan) segala urusan (kegiatan); 2 cak kenalan.
2. Latar Belakang
Suatu program, dibuat dengan menggunakan database terlebih dahulu. Setelah database diolah dengan baik, dan sudah siap pakai. Antara database dan program masih tidak bisa terhubung. Lalu bagaimana solusinya? Jangan khawatir. Kita membutuhkan koneksi untuk menghubungkan di antara keduanya.
Dimana koneksi inilah yang menjadi perantara antara program yang kita buat dan database yang telah diolah sebelumnya.
Mengapa dengan objek oriented?? Karena disini kita akan membuat program dengan OOP(Object Oriented Programming) dimana semua masalah atau problem kita bentuk menjadi objek.
Suatu program, dibuat dengan menggunakan database terlebih dahulu. Setelah database diolah dengan baik, dan sudah siap pakai. Antara database dan program masih tidak bisa terhubung. Lalu bagaimana solusinya? Jangan khawatir. Kita membutuhkan koneksi untuk menghubungkan di antara keduanya.
Dimana koneksi inilah yang menjadi perantara antara program yang kita buat dan database yang telah diolah sebelumnya.
Mengapa dengan objek oriented?? Karena disini kita akan membuat program dengan OOP(Object Oriented Programming) dimana semua masalah atau problem kita bentuk menjadi objek.
3. Maksud dan Tujuan
- Untuk menghubungkan antara program dan database
- Untuk jembatan antara program dan database
- Mudah mengubah program
- Memberi fleksibilitas yang lebih
- Digunakan luas dalam teknik peranti lunak skala besar
- OOP lebih mudah dikembangkan dan dirawat
Dengan koneksi ini, diharapkan program dapat berjalan dengan lancar. Karena sudah terhubunga atau terkoneksi dengan database.
B. Uraian
1. Alat dan Bahan
- PC
- Text editor
2. Durasi Waktu
5 menit
5 menit
3. Tahapan
- Buka text editor kita(saya menggunakan sublime text)
- Buat file bernama koneksi.php
- Ketikkan dahulu yang akan mengoneksikan kita ke database.
Penjelasan :
- $koneksi merupakan variabel yang dimana di dalamnya nanti mengandung koneksi ke database nya. Mengapa menggunakan variabel karena nanti akan mudah ketika dimasuukkan ke dalam query.
- new mysqli ini kita telah membuat objek dengan sering disebut instantisasi objek.
- ("<nama_host>", "<username_db>", "<pwrd_rb>", "<nama_db>") disinilah koneksi itu terbentuk.
- mysqli_connect_errno() berfungsi mengembalikan kode kesalahan dari kesalahan koneksi terakhir, jika ada.
- trigger_error() berfungsi untuk menciptakan pesan kesalahan tingkat pengguna, dengan handler error bawaan, atau dengan fungsi yang ditentukan pengguna yang ditetapkan oleh fungsi set_error_handler ().
C. Kesimpulan
Koneksi ke database tidak hanya bisa dibuat pada php native saja, dengan OOP pun koneksi juga dapat dibuat. Bahkan, lebih mudah dan lebih simple.
Koneksi ke database tidak hanya bisa dibuat pada php native saja, dengan OOP pun koneksi juga dapat dibuat. Bahkan, lebih mudah dan lebih simple.
D. Hasil yang
diperoleh
Bila dikoneksikan antara program dan database akan terkoneksi.
Bila dikoneksikan antara program dan database akan terkoneksi.
E. Referensi
https://kbbi.web.id/koneksi
https://id.wikipedia.org/wiki/Pemrograman_berorientasi_objek
https://www.w3schools.com/php/func_mysqli_connect_errno.asp
https://www.w3schools.com/PhP/func_error_trigger_error.asp
https://kbbi.web.id/koneksi
https://id.wikipedia.org/wiki/Pemrograman_berorientasi_objek
https://www.w3schools.com/php/func_mysqli_connect_errno.asp
https://www.w3schools.com/PhP/func_error_trigger_error.asp
Tidak ada komentar:
Write komentar